About this property

Low-maintenance living in a fantastic location! This move-in-ready townhome offers easy access to major highways, George Bush Turnpike & Central Expressway, as well as tons of restaurants, shopping at Richardson’s City Line and Firewheel Town Center. Just 2 miles from the 417-acre Breckinridge Park. The HOA handles yard and exterior maintenance, giving you more time to enjoy the beautiful community pool and green space. Inside, you’ll find fresh interior paint, professionally cleaned carpet, and a flexible floor plan featuring two spacious bedrooms with walk-in closets. Large living room with soaring ceilings. The upstairs game room makes a great second living area, home office, or playroom. Tons of storage space including an attached 2-car garage and huge storage closet off the laundry room. Additional highlights include a new water heater in December 2025 with a 6 year warranty and HVAC replaced in 2019. Washer, dryer, and refrigerator to convey with sale. Zoned to Plano ISD schools, this move-in ready home is ready for a new owner!

Texas

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
